@ -23,6 +23,8 @@ PicoBot 只有一个二进制,提供两种模式:
| Gateway | `cargo run -- gateway` | 组装服务、监听 HTTP/WebSocket、运行渠道、会话、调度器和后台任务 |
| CLI client | `cargo run -- chat` | 运行 Ratatui UI通过 WebSocket 使用 Gateway不持有业务状态 |
CLI TUI 在 `~/.picobot/tui_client_id` 保存非敏感客户端标识,并通过 WebSocket 查询参数 `client_id` 传给 Gateway。`cli_chat` 以该标识作为稳定 chat scope重连时恢复内存中的当前 dialogGateway 重启后则恢复该 scope 最近活跃的未归档 dialog。无效或缺失的标识会退化为连接级随机 scope。
Gateway 启动时会切换进程工作目录到 `workspace_dir`。因此所有相对路径都应按 workspace 解释,不能假设仍位于源码仓库。

WebSocket dialog 操作通过 `ControlMessage` 携带一次性回复通道。Gateway 在统一 message processor 中调用 `SessionManager`,再将 `SessionEvent` 回传给发起者。Bus 只承载消息,不解释操作。
TUI 的历史回放同样走 control 队列:`get_session_history` 先校验 session 属于当前客户端 scope再由 SessionManager 从 Storage 读取最近消息。单次查询限制为 12000 条TUI 默认请求最近 1000 条;迟到的历史响应只有在目标仍是当前 dialog 时才允许更新界面。
Agent worker 发出的异步回复和通知在 OutboundMessage metadata 中标记来源 session`cli_chat` 将其映射为 WebSocket `session_id`。TUI 切换 dialog 后不渲染其他 session 的迟到结果;结果仍按原 session 持久化,切回时通过历史回放显示。
